Moldavian Evening to the Charity Center for Refugees

Today, 26th of June, at the initiative and invitation of Tolerance Club Moldova, the volunteers of AVI Moldova plan to organize a nice national evening for the Charity Center for Refugees.

The Agenda:

  • Meeting the participants
  • Division of the participants in 4 groups
  • Visiting the following workshops by each group:
  1. National Holidays and customs
  2. Casa Mare and the life style of Moldovans
  3. The history of Moldova and Chisinau
  4. National Arts and folklore

Afterwards, is planned a cultural programme which will include national dances, national songs and national food :)
